PHS to face region powerhouse tonight

Published 11:59 pm Thursday, October 1, 2009

The Pleasant Home Eagles are ready to use the momentum gained from getting their first win last week to face off against Brantley tonight.

Last Friday night, the Eagles ran their way to a 28-6 win over Coffeeville when Tyler Barbaree carried the ball 135 yards to score three touchdowns to help lead his team to the win.

On defense, Pleasant Home only allowed 54 total yards, most of which came in the last minute.

Before their first win, the Eagles were defeated by Samson, Ariton, Geneva County and McKenzie.

Brantley will not be any easier, as the Bulldogs are undefeated in Class 1A, Region 2 play at 3-0. The Eagles are 0-3 in their region.

“These kids have kind of been down on themselves because we’ve been down in a lot of close games and ended up falling short in a lot of them,” Pleasant Home coach Robert Bradford said. “They finally got the monkey off their backs, as you would say. Now, we can push on and try to accomplish our goals for the rest of the year.”

Kickoff in Pleasant Home is at 7 p.m.
